    Hey does anyone have a Nokia N97 mobile phone ???

    I do Have had it for about 5 months now, After about 2 months it stopped sending messages all going to out box rather than sending and i wasn't recieving all my text messages, Other than that the phone seemed to be ok,
    Sent it of to Optus who by-passed it to Nokia, and they said nothing was wrong they did an update on it and that was it 3 weeks later i had the phone back, Now almost 2 months later the exact same thing has happened

    Anyone had this problem???

    sounds like a network problem, not a phone issue. Check the message centre number under message settings matches one of the correct optus ones.

    Try changing it to one of these till it works:

    Optus Australia +61412025989
    Optus Australia +61411990000
    Optus Australia +61411990001
    Optus Australia +61411990003

    Be sure to include the + symbol.
